What is a civil defense shelter? How does it differ from a bomb shelter?

A civil defense shelter and a bomb shelter are different classes of shelters and have different purposes. The simplest shelter - any place where you can hide from danger - has minimal construction requirements. A prefabricated shelter is a shelter that meets the norms and standards. There can be different classes of protection. Bomb shelters are capital construction. They are designed to protect people in accordance with all rules and standards, with the necessary communications, and are most often built as underground. Depending on the function (for example, "shelters from direct bombing" are built at different depths).

What is the difference between an above-ground and underground civil defense shelter?

There is no fundamental difference in functionality - for sheltering from blast waves or debris. However, each type of shelter has its advantages and disadvantages in terms of price, operation, and installation time. Ground-based: - more expensive to manufacture (much more concrete); - faster installation (1-2 days); - more expensive delivery (due to the weight of concrete); - harder to heat; - does not require land works and design; - no matter where the groundwater is. Underground: - Requires a project (development time up to 2 months); - expensive earthworks and waterproofing; - cheaper construction, easier to heat

Why are there different shelters for different consumers?

These are the requirements of SBC B.2.2.5-2023 and DSTU 9195-2022, which clearly indicate the areas required for safe shelter for various institutions and population groups

What do civil defense structures protect against?

From blast waves and debris, depending on the protection class of the shelter required by the Customer. A-4: 100 kPa; А-3: 200 kPa; A-2: 300 kPa; A-1: 500 kPa. To put it in perspective, a 70 kPa wave destroys brick buildings. An air shock wave of 100 kPa kills an adult. A 200 kPa shock destroys military equipment. What is a radiation protection shelter (RPS) and how does it differ?

A radiation shelter (RPS) primarily protects against radiation. It is much more expensive than the simplest shelter, because a radiation shelter must have additional rooms, which significantly increases the total area of the shelter. In addition, the radiation protection coefficient and ventilation and life support systems must be designed to allow people to stay in the shelter without leaving it for at least 48 hours.

Which of your shelters has the highest protection class, above ground or underground?

Both types of shelters, the Hobbit and Fortress, comply with the SBC and DSTU standards. According to these standards, civil defense shelters must withstand an air blast wave of 100 kPa. As a standard, these shelters can withstand it and also withstand the debris specified in the calculation. At the same time, the design of our shelters incorporates engineering solutions that allow us to increase the protection class by replacing the reinforcement and concrete used in production and by deepening the structure underground. Therefore, the strength and level of protection of the shelter depends on the task, not on the installation location.
